<scp>Gapsplit</scp> : efficient random sampling for non-convex constraint-based models

Thomas C. Keaty, Paul A. Jensen

2020Bioinformatics19 citationsDOIOpen Access PDF

Abstract

SUMMARY: Gapsplit generates random samples from convex and non-convex constraint-based models by targeting under-sampled regions of the solution space. Gapsplit provides uniform coverage of linear, mixed-integer and general non-linear models. AVAILABILITY AND IMPLEMENTATION: Python and Matlab source code are freely available at http://jensenlab.net/tools.
